Owning a car in Tarrytown, NY, is not always necessary. This town offers several transportation options that make commuting easy, even in varying weather conditions. The village sits along the Hudson River and is serviced by the Metro-North Railroad. This train system provides a convenient way to travel to New York City and other nearby areas.

Local buses also connect Tarrytown with surrounding towns and cities. These buses can be especially handy during inclement weather. Tarrytown's location also means that ride-sharing services like Uber and Lyft are readily available. These options offer flexibility and can be a good choice, especially during busy commute times or when the weather is unpredictable.

For those who prefer to walk or bike, Tarrytown provides pathways and bike lanes. However, it is important to consider the weather when choosing these modes of transport. Cold winters and hot summers can make these options less comfortable. Nevertheless, having multiple transportation choices makes life in Tarrytown convenient and accessible.
